Output ecce2609fb8ea2f95ef783520a2c5b66221bf1cf491e179c311b9e589ffe2833:0

value
59856
script pubkey
OP_0 OP_PUSHBYTES_20 ea764375f34067fcf3abf458b1cae7ceb864256d
address
tb1qafmyxa0ngpnleuat73vtrjh8e6uxgftdhtdyla
transaction
ecce2609fb8ea2f95ef783520a2c5b66221bf1cf491e179c311b9e589ffe2833